The auto toss/ auto include angle is going to be suspect this meeting if the opening day card is any indication of who's going to field their expected stables here - a ton of new faces on the backside, while guys/gals that usually show up with large stables of auto-tosses (Wasulik, Paquete, Fontana) conspicuously absent from opening day. On the other side, Ziadie denied stalls, and a very watchful eye on the Ness operation may take a dent out of the number of auto-includes. Hopefully we'll still get our 50+ Janet Del Castillio runners. And our Regina Sealock mounts. ;) |

It's possible. Can they both win? Sure, but IMO they will be vastly overbet. I have made enough money at Tampa in past years playing against horses like these two. They both show extremely fast works elsewhere and ZERO works at Tampa. I have seen too many fast horses flop at short prices on the Tampa sand. I will let them both beat me. Truth be told, I am more interested in the early pick 4 than the late one. |

The first thing I think when I see horses like this is, why Tampa? Why not wait two weeks and run at Gulfstream? Well, a quick perusal of the Gulfstream condition book shows me he can run for 100k on Jan 9 or......run at Tampa. There is nothing for a N1X 3yr old sprinting in the first book. |
